Pelvic Cramps
Painful sensations in the lower abdomen or pelvic region, often associated with menstrual periods, ovulation, or various medical conditions.
Vaginal Bleeding
Any bleeding from the vagina, including menstruation as well as bleeding that may result from other causes such as injury, infection, or conditions of the reproductive system.
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ection
A fertility treatment procedure in which a single sperm is injected directly into an egg.
Gestational Carrier
A carrier who is not related to the fetus. In this case, a woman with ovaries but no uterus uses her own egg and the man’s sperm to create the embryo, which is then placed within the carrier’s uterus.
